BonSue earned her Associate’s degree at St Petersburg College and then pursued a Liberal Arts degree at the University of Tampa. The majority of BonSue’s business career was dedicated to the field of Human Resources. In 2004, she left her position as Director of HR for a local engineering firm, to pursue her dream of writing.
More than a decade ago, BonSue became involved in the cause to preserve and restore the historic Belleview Biltmore Hotel. Although the fight to save the hotel was lost in 2015, she is determined to maintain a record of the hotel’s grandeur and significant historical contributions to local development, by including these details within the storylines of a four-book series, titled “Spirits of the Belleview Biltmore.” The first three novels in the series, “Pearls,” “Ripples,” and “Redemption” are available in print, e-book and audio formats. She is already hard at work on the final installment in the series, “Nails.”
BonSue also wrote and illustrated a children’s educational and interactive activity book, titled “Where Do You Live, Exactly?” which uses the principle of the Russian nesting doll, to reduce the size of the universe one page at a time, until at the end of the book, the child reaches his/her own home. And she wrote a children’s book, titled “Coal for Christmas,” which is a story about two little boys whose names are on Santa’s Naughty List. When one boy turns all the toys in Santa’s sack into lumps of coal, it’s up to the other boy to help save Christmas for his little brother and all the other Nice Children (Available in print & audio formats.)
